How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Milwaukee?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Milwaukee Studio Apartments | $1,413 | $675 | $10,000+ |
| Milwaukee 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,629 | $486 | $10,000+ |
| Milwaukee 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,093 | $604 | $7,595 |
| Milwaukee 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,559 | $800 | $10,000+ |
| Milwaukee 4 Bedroom Apartments | $3,562 | $1,350 | $10,000+ |
| Milwaukee 5 Bedroom Apartments | $2,300 | $2,300 | $2,300 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Milwaukee Apartments with Parking
What is the Cheapest Parking apartment in Milwaukee?
Currently the most affordable Apartment in Milwaukee with Parking is at City Square Apartments listed at $445.
How much is the average rent for Milwaukee Apartments with Parking?
The average rent for a Apartment in Milwaukee with Parking is $1,730.
What is the largest Milwaukee Apartment for rent with Parking?
Today's Apartment with Parking and the most square footage in Milwaukee is a 3,268 square feet unit starting from $1,765 at City Green Apartments.
What is the average size for Milwaukee Apartments for rent with Parking?
The average size for a rental with Parking in Milwaukee is currently at 853 sq ft.
